Understand Common Frozen Pipe Causes in Arvada
Frozen pipes are a common issue in Arvada, particularly during colder months, due to various factors. Understanding these causes is the first step in effective frozen pipe repair. One primary reason is the freezing and expansion of water within pipes, leading to potential bursts. This often occurs when heat loss from exterior walls or inadequate insulation allows outdoor temperatures to drop below freezing. In Arvada, where winters can be harsh, even well-insulated homes may experience pipe issues if not adequately prepared.
Another common cause is the accumulation of debris or mineral deposits inside pipes, which can restrict water flow and create areas prone to freezing. Poorly installed or maintained plumbing systems may also contribute to the problem. Additionally, sudden temperature changes during late fall or early spring transitions can catch unprepared residents off guard, leading to frozen pipes. Prepare Your Home for Winter to Prevent Freezing
Before winter sets in, take proactive steps to protect your Arvada home from freezing pipes. Start by insulating exposed pipes in your attic, basement, and crawl spaces. Use foam insulation or pre-cut pipe sleeves to create a barrier against extreme cold. Additionally, consider installing thermal expansion tanks on your water heater to alleviate pressure buildup caused by temperature changes.
Regularly checking for leaks and addressing them promptly is another crucial preventive measure. If you notice any signs of moisture or strange noises coming from pipes, don’t wait. Identify Signs of Frozen Pipes Early On
Recognizing the signs of frozen pipes early is a crucial step in avoiding costly repairs and unnecessary inconveniences. In Arvada, where cold winters can be harsh, it’s essential to be vigilant. Keep an eye out for subtle indicators such as reduced water pressure or unusual noises coming from your plumbing system. If you notice your water heater taking longer than usual to warm up or see ice forming on exposed pipes, these could be early warnings of a potential freeze-up.

Emergency Steps When Pipes Freeze and Burst
When pipes freeze and burst, it’s crucial to take immediate action. The first step is to turn off your home’s water supply to prevent further damage. Once that’s done, assess the situation – if only a small section of pipe is frozen and intact, you might be able to thaw it out using a hairdryer or heat lamp, carefully applying heat until the ice melts. However, if the pipe has burst, act swiftly.
